Why do we need a Servo Stabilizer?

In today’s modern world, Voltage stabilizers are an integral need from Industrial operations to household needs for electrical stability problems. The major purpose of the voltage stabilizer is to convert unregulated input electrical signals into regulated output signals.

The different types of voltage stabilizers are: 

  • Relay type voltage stabilizer
  • Static voltage stabilizers and
  • Servo controlled voltage stabilizer.

Among the three, Servo voltage stabilizers serve the purpose of providing steady output voltage utilizing built-in servo motors. Servo stabilizers are also called automatic voltage regulators as the microprocessors present inside the electronic circuit unit actuates the servo motors when it receives a fluctuating input voltage signal.  

The servo motors move across the autotransformer and regulate the required output voltage which is transferred to the buck-boost transformer (DC to DC converter for step-up or step-down purposes).

What are the different types of Servo Stabilizer?

  • Single Phase Servo Based Voltage Stabilizers
  • Three Phase Balanced type Servo Based Voltage Stabilizers
  • Three Phase Unbalanced type Servo Based Voltage Stabilizers

The single-phase servo voltage stabilizers comprise servo motors linked with autotransformers and transfer the regulated voltage to the buck-boost transformer working on the principle discussed above. In the case of a three-phase balanced type, a servo motor is coupled with three autotransformers providing modulated steady output voltage instantaneously. 

The unbalanced type holds three different servo motors interfaced with individual autotransformers providing effective output voltage. Compared to other voltage stabilizers, servo stabilizers provide precise high voltage stabilization, rapid functioning, high reliability and serve for domestic and industrial electrical appliances.

Applications of a Servo Stabilizer

  • A wide variety of applications such as industrial, domestic, commercial systems can be protected using EVR power Servo voltage stabilizers. Servo stabilizers provide safeguarding solutions for electronic devices protecting their electrical/electronic components from serious damage.

  • The input signal fluctuation causes heat energy causing premature failure to the sensitive circuit board and microprocessor chips. The recurrence of fluctuating signals causes permanent damage to the electric and electronic system. Therefore, Servo stabilizers provide a stable flow of input voltage balanced according to the electric system and prevent overheating. The effective performance keeps the electrical system in ambient conditions providing longevity.

  • In recent times, the rapid advancement of the Information technology revolution requires an uninterrupted stable power supply for the use of high computing power in large Data centres and IT-based tech parks to avoid several factors such as network issues, data fragmentation and server problems. Servo stabilizer provides 100 % protection to the overall electrical devices supplying precisely engineered output power supply.

  • Also, real-time scenarios such as live broadcasting studios, concerts and massive live events require standardized input voltage to avoid critical failures for up and down streaming of data. Automatic voltage regulators can handle heavy voltage fluctuations and provide long-hour service for outdoor conditions.
